共用方式為


Outlook) (RecurrencePattern.Interval 屬性

會傳回或設定 Long ,指定發生次數之間指定週期類型的單位數。 讀取/寫入。

語法

expressionInterval

表達 代表 RecurrencePattern 物件的 變數。

註解

在設定 PatternEndDate 之前,必須先設定 Interval 屬性。

例如,將 Interval 屬性設定為 2,並將 RecurrenceType 屬性設定為 olRecursWeekly ,會導致模式每隔一周發生一次。

RecurrenceType 設定為 olRecursYearNtholRecursYear 時,Interval 屬性就表示發生週期性工作之間的年數。 例如,Interval 等於 1 表示每年循環、Interval 等於 2 表示每 2 年循環,依此類推。

範例

這個 Visual Basic for Applications 範例會使用GetRecurrencePattern來取得新建立AppointmentItemRecurrencePattern物件。 RecurrenceTypeDayOfWeekMaskPatternStartDateIntervalPatternEndDateSubject屬性已設定,會儲存約會,然後以模式顯示:「從 2003 年 1 月 21 日到 2004 年 12 月 21 日下午 2:00 到下午 5:00,每隔 3 周 () 一次。」

Sub CreateAppointment() 
 
 Dim myApptItem As AppointmentItem 
 
 Dim myRecurrPatt As RecurrencePattern 
 
 
 
 
 
 Set myApptItem = Application.CreateItem(olAppointmentItem) 
 
 Set myRecurrPatt = myApptItem.GetRecurrencePattern 
 
 myRecurrPatt.RecurrenceType = olRecursWeekly 
 
 myRecurrPatt.DayOfWeekMask = olMonday 
 
 myRecurrPatt.PatternStartDate = #1/21/2003 2:00:00 PM# 
 
 myRecurrPatt.Interval = 3 
 
 myRecurrPatt.PatternEndDate = #12/21/2004 5:00:00 PM# 
 
 myApptItem.Subject = "Important Appointment" 
 
 myApptItem.Save 
 
 myApptItem.Display 
 
 Set myOlApp = Nothing 
 
 Set myApptItem = Nothing 
 
 Set myRecurrPatt = Nothing 
 
End Sub

另請參閱

RecurrencePattern 物件

操作方法:建立約會做為行事曆上的會議

支援和意見反應

有關於 Office VBA 或這份文件的問題或意見反應嗎? 如需取得支援服務並提供意見反應的相關指導,請參閱 Office VBA 支援與意見反應